I had fun listing what this Version 7.2.9 actually changes in how we consume news. Because that’s what matters. Check it out:

  • Offline reading: Taking the train to Paris from Rodez station? Heading to a quiet spot in Lévézou where the signal’s dodgy? Your articles are saved. You can read them later, no buffering.
  • Targeted notifications: Say goodbye to spam. You can choose to only get what really matters to you. Live results from the Centre Presse Aveyron Newspaper, traffic alerts for the Millau viaduct, or just cultural news. You’re in control.
  • Super smooth performance: Scrolling is seamless, photos load without lag. Even on older iPhone models, it runs like a charm. That’s what we call respecting our readers.
